Newly elected President of Moldova to be sworn in

Newly elected President of Moldova Nicolae Timofti will be sworn in on Friday in Chisinau. Around 500 guests are expected to participate on the inauguration. EU prepares progress report on Montenegro

“Montenegro is in principle close to opening accession negotiations. Now it needs to run this final straight towards this very ambitious goal,” President of the European Commission Jose Manuel Baroso announced. However, he stressed that significant work remains to be done.
